在 PL/SQL 中计算布尔值

Posted

技术标签:

【中文标题】在 PL/SQL 中计算布尔值【英文标题】:Evaluating boolean values in PL/SQL 【发布时间】:2011-06-04 11:56:08 【问题描述】:

假设我有一个布尔变量foo

目前我用IF foo = FALSE THEN ...来比较一下,但是看起来很麻烦。一定有更好的办法!

另一种方法是将变量重命名为not_foo,但这并没有真正让它变得更简单。

有没有像IF !foo THEN ...这样的测试方法?

【问题讨论】:

【参考方案1】:

我认为你可以使用

  IF NOT foo THEN...

声明。 Check out this link for more information

【讨论】:

以上是关于在 PL/SQL 中计算布尔值的主要内容,如果未能解决你的问题,请参考以下文章

通过 Java 调用 PL\SQL:将参数注册为布尔值

具有布尔返回值的 pl/sql 函数的 OracleType?

使用带有布尔输入参数的 PL/SQL 在 oracle 中调用 java 存储过程

odp.net 可以将参数传递给布尔 pl/sql 参数吗?

计算 Python 列表中真正布尔值的数量

布尔值数据类型